Special data
- Nonce: 1
- Is contract? Yes
-
Contract code:
0x608060405234801561001057600080fd5b506004361061014d5760003560e01c806378ed5d1f116100c357806398969e821161007c57806398969e8214610303578063ab7de09814610316578063c346253d14610329578063d1abb9071461033c578063f2fde38b1461034f578063fbe6cf6a1461036257600080fd5b806378ed5d1f1461026957806388bba42f1461027c5780638da5cb5b1461028f5780638dbdbe6d146102a05780638f10369a146102b357806393f1a40b146102bc57600080fd5b8063228cb73311610115578063228cb733146101c85780632f940c70146101f357806351eb05a61461020657806357a5b58c1461023b57806366da58151461024e578063715018a61461026157600080fd5b8063081e3eda146101525780630ad58d2f146101695780631526fe271461017e57806317caf6f1146101ac57806318fccc76146101b5575b600080fd5b6002545b6040519081526020015b60405180910390f35b61017c610177366004611abd565b610375565b005b61019161018c366004611a1d565b61052e565b60408051938452602084019290925290820152606001610160565b61015660065481565b61017c6101c3366004611a4d565b610561565b6001546101db906001600160a01b031681565b6040516001600160a01b039091168152602001610160565b61017c610201366004611a4d565b6106ca565b610219610214366004611a1d565b610815565b6040805182518152602080840151908201529181015190820152606001610160565b61017c610249366004611991565b610a59565b61017c61025c366004611a1d565b610aab565b61017c610b19565b6101db610277366004611a1d565b610b8d565b61017c61028a366004611aea565b610bb7565b6000546001600160a01b03166101db565b61017c6102ae366004611abd565b610d56565b61015660075481565b6102ee6102ca366004611a4d565b60056020908152600092835260408084209091529082529020805460019091015482565b60408051928352602083019190915201610160565b610156610311366004611a4d565b610f07565b61017c610324366004611a7c565b6110e3565b6101db610337366004611a1d565b611299565b61017c61034a366004611abd565b6112a9565b61017c61035d366004611975565b6114c6565b61017c610370366004611975565b6115b0565b600061038084610815565b6000858152600560209081526040808320338452909152902081519192509064e8d4a51000906103b09086611c5f565b6103ba9190611c3f565b8160010160008282546103cd9190611c7e565b90915550508054849082906000906103e6908490611cbd565b9250508190555060006004868154811061041057634e487b7160e01b600052603260045260246000fd5b6000918252602090912001546001600160a01b0316905080156104965781546040516344af0fa760e01b81526001600160a01b038316916344af0fa791610463918a9133918a9160009190600401611bb7565b600060405180830381600087803b15801561047d57600080fd5b505af1158015610491573d6000803e3d6000fd5b505050505b6104d88486600389815481106104bc57634e487b7160e01b600052603260045260246000fd5b6000918252602090912001546001600160a01b031691906115fc565b836001600160a01b031686336001600160a01b03167f8166bf25f8a2b7ed3c85049207da4358d16edbed977d23fa2ee6f0dde3ec21328860405161051e91815260200190565b60405180910390a4505050505050565b6002818154811061053e57600080fd5b600091825260209091206003909102018054600182015460029092015490925083565b600061056c83610815565b6000848152600560209081526040808320338452909152812082518154939450909264e8d4a510009161059e91611c5f565b6105a89190611c3f565b905060008260010154826105bc9190611c7e565b60018401839055905080156105e2576001546105e2906001600160a01b031686836115fc565b60006004878154811061060557634e487b7160e01b600052603260045260246000fd5b6000918252602090912001546001600160a01b03169050801561068a5783546040516344af0fa760e01b81526001600160a01b038316916344af0fa791610657918b9133918c91899190600401611bb7565b600060405180830381600087803b15801561067157600080fd5b505af1158015610685573d6000803e3d6000fd5b505050505b604051828152879033907f71bab65ced2e5750775a0613be067df48ef06cf92a496ebf7663ae06609249549060200160405180910390a350505050505050565b6000828152600560209081526040808320338452909152812080548282556001820183905560048054929391928690811061071557634e487b7160e01b600052603260045260246000fd5b6000918252602090912001546001600160a01b03169050801561079a576040516344af0fa760e01b81526001600160a01b038216906344af0fa790610767908890339089906000908190600401611bb7565b600060405180830381600087803b15801561078157600080fd5b505af1158015610795573d6000803e3d6000fd5b505050505b6107c08483600388815481106104bc57634e487b7160e01b600052603260045260246000fd5b836001600160a01b031685336001600160a01b03167f2cac5e20e1541d836381527a43f651851e302817b71dc8e810284e69210c1c6b8560405161080691815260200190565b60405180910390a45050505050565b61083960405180606001604052806000815260200160008152602001600081525090565b6002828154811061085a57634e487b7160e01b600052603260045260246000fd5b600091825260209182902060408051606081018252600390930290910180548352600181015493830184905260020154908201529150421115610a54576000600383815481106108ba57634e487b7160e01b600052603260045260246000fd5b6000918252602090912001546040516370a0823160e01b81523060048201526001600160a01b03909116906370a082319060240160206040518083038186803b15801561090657600080fd5b505afa15801561091a573d6000803e3d6000fd5b505050506040513d601f19601f8201168201806040525081019061093e9190611a35565b905080156109b75760008260200151426109589190611cbd565b905060006006548460400151600754846109729190611c5f565b61097c9190611c5f565b6109869190611c3f565b90508261099864e8d4a5100083611c5f565b6109a29190611c3f565b845185906109b1908390611c27565b90525050505b42602083015260028054839190859081106109e257634e487b7160e01b600052603260045260246000fd5b600091825260209182902083516003929092020190815582820151600182015560409283015160029091015583810151845183519182529181018490529182015283907fcb7325664a4a3b7c7223eefc492a97ca4fdf94d46884621e5a8fae5a04b2b9d29060600160405180910390a2505b919050565b8060005b81811015610aa557610a94848483818110610a8857634e487b7160e01b600052603260045260246000fd5b90506020020135610815565b50610a9e81611d00565b9050610a5d565b50505050565b6000546001600160a01b03163314610ade5760405162461bcd60e51b8152600401610ad590611b82565b60405180910390fd5b60078190556040518181527fde89cb17ac7f58f94792b3e91e086ed85403819c24ceea882491f960ccb1a2789060200160405180910390a150565b6000546001600160a01b03163314610b435760405162461bcd60e51b8152600401610ad590611b82565b600080546040516001600160a01b03909116907f8be0079c531659141344cd1fd0a4f28419497f9722a3daafe3b4186f6b6457e0908390a3600080546001600160a01b0319169055565b60038181548110610b9d57600080fd5b6000918252602090912001546001600160a01b0316905081565b6000546001600160a01b03163314610be15760405162461bcd60e51b8152600401610ad590611b82565b8260028581548110610c0357634e487b7160e01b600052603260045260246000fd5b906000526020600020906003020160020154600654610c229190611cbd565b610c2c9190611c27565b6006819055508260028581548110610c5457634e487b7160e01b600052603260045260246000fd5b9060005260206000209060030201600201819055508015610cc0578160048581548110610c9157634e487b7160e01b600052603260045260246000fd5b9060005260206000200160006101000a8154816001600160a01b0302191690836001600160a01b031602179055505b80610d005760048481548110610ce657634e487b7160e01b600052603260045260246000fd5b6000918252602090912001546001600160a01b0316610d02565b815b6001600160a01b0316847f95895a6ab1df54420d241b55243258a33e61b2194db66c1179ec521aae8e18658584604051610d489291909182521515602082015260400190565b60405180910390a350505050565b6000610d6184610815565b60008581526005602090815260408083206001600160a01b0387168452909152812080549293509185918391610d98908490611c27565b9091555050815164e8d4a5100090610db09086611c5f565b610dba9190611c3f565b816001016000828254610dcd9190611be6565b92505081905550600060048681548110610df757634e487b7160e01b600052603260045260246000fd5b6000918252602090912001546001600160a01b031690508015610e7d5781546040516344af0fa760e01b81526001600160a01b038316916344af0fa791610e4a918a918991829160009190600401611bb7565b600060405180830381600087803b158015610e6457600080fd5b505af1158015610e78573d6000803e3d6000fd5b505050505b610ec133308760038a81548110610ea457634e487b7160e01b600052603260045260246000fd5b6000918252602090912001546001600160a01b031692919061165f565b836001600160a01b031686336001600160a01b03167f02d7e648dd130fc184d383e55bb126ac4c9c60e8f94bf05acdf557ba2d540b478860405161051e91815260200190565b60008060028481548110610f2b57634e487b7160e01b600052603260045260246000fd5b60009182526020808320604080516060810182526003948502909201805483526001810154838501526002015482820152888552600583528085206001600160a01b03891686529092529083208151835492955090939092909188908110610fa357634e487b7160e01b600052603260045260246000fd5b6000918252602090912001546040516370a0823160e01b81523060048201526001600160a01b03909116906370a082319060240160206040518083038186803b158015610fef57600080fd5b505afa158015611003573d6000803e3d6000fd5b505050506040513d601f19601f820116820180604052508101906110279190611a35565b905083602001514211801561103b57508015155b156110ab5760008460200151426110529190611cbd565b9050600060065486604001516007548461106c9190611c5f565b6110769190611c5f565b6110809190611c3f565b90508261109264e8d4a5100083611c5f565b61109c9190611c3f565b6110a69085611c27565b935050505b6001830154835464e8d4a51000906110c4908590611c5f565b6110ce9190611c3f565b6110d89190611c7e565b979650505050505050565b6000546001600160a01b0316331461110d5760405162461bcd60e51b8152600401610ad590611b82565b61111682611697565b82600660008282546111289190611c27565b909155505060038054600181810183557fc2575a0e9e593c00f959f8c92f12db2869c3395a3b0502d05e2516446f71f85b90910180546001600160a01b038087166001600160a01b03199283168117909355600480548086019091557f8a35acfbc15ff81a39ae7d344fd709f28e8600b4aa8c65c6b64bfe7fe36bd19b01805491871691909216811790915560408051606081018252600080825242602083019081529282018a8152600280548089018255925291519087027f405787fa12a823e0f2b7631cc41b3ba8828b3321ca811111fa75cd3aa3bb5ace81019190915591517f405787fa12a823e0f2b7631cc41b3ba8828b3321ca811111fa75cd3aa3bb5acf830155517f405787fa12a823e0f2b7631cc41b3ba8828b3321ca811111fa75cd3aa3bb5ad0909101559254909161126191611cbd565b6040518681527f81ee0f8c5c46e2cb41984886f77a84181724abb86c32a5f6de539b07509d45e59060200160405180910390a4505050565b60048181548110610b9d57600080fd5b60006112b484610815565b6000858152600560209081526040808320338452909152812082518154939450909264e8d4a51000916112e691611c5f565b6112f09190611c3f565b905060008260010154826113049190611c7e565b845190915064e8d4a510009061131a9088611c5f565b6113249190611c3f565b61132e9083611c7e565b6001840155825486908490600090611347908490611cbd565b9091555050801561136957600154611369906001600160a01b031686836115fc565b60006004888154811061138c57634e487b7160e01b600052603260045260246000fd5b6000918252602090912001546001600160a01b0316905080156114115783546040516344af0fa760e01b81526001600160a01b038316916344af0fa7916113de918c9133918c91899190600401611bb7565b600060405180830381600087803b1580156113f857600080fd5b505af115801561140c573d6000803e3d6000fd5b505050505b611437868860038b815481106104bc57634e487b7160e01b600052603260045260246000fd5b856001600160a01b031688336001600160a01b03167f8166bf25f8a2b7ed3c85049207da4358d16edbed977d23fa2ee6f0dde3ec21328a60405161147d91815260200190565b60405180910390a4604051828152889033907f71bab65ced2e5750775a0613be067df48ef06cf92a496ebf7663ae06609249549060200160405180910390a35050505050505050565b6000546001600160a01b031633146114f05760405162461bcd60e51b8152600401610ad590611b82565b6001600160a01b0381166115555760405162461bcd60e51b815260206004820152602660248201527f4f776e61626c653a206e6577206f776e657220697320746865207a65726f206160448201526564647265737360d01b6064820152608401610ad5565b600080546040516001600160a01b03808516939216917f8be0079c531659141344cd1fd0a4f28419497f9722a3daafe3b4186f6b6457e091a3600080546001600160a01b0319166001600160a01b0392909216919091179055565b60025460005b818110156115f7576000818152600560209081526040808320338452909152902054156115e7576115e78184610561565b6115f081611d00565b90506115b6565b505050565b6040516001600160a01b0383166024820152604481018290526115f790849063a9059cbb60e01b906064015b60408051601f198184030181529190526020810180516001600160e01b03166001600160e01b031990931692909217909152611739565b6040516001600160a01b0380851660248301528316604482015260648101829052610aa59085906323b872dd60e01b90608401611628565b60025460005b818110156115f757826001600160a01b0316600382815481106116d057634e487b7160e01b600052603260045260246000fd5b6000918252602090912001546001600160a01b031614156117295760405162461bcd60e51b81526020600482015260136024820152726164643a206578697374696e6720706f6f6c3f60681b6044820152606401610ad5565b61173281611d00565b905061169d565b600061178e826040518060400160405280602081526020017f5361666545524332303a206c6f772d6c6576656c2063616c6c206661696c6564815250856001600160a01b031661180b9092919063ffffffff16565b8051909150156115f757808060200190518101906117ac9190611a01565b6115f75760405162461bcd60e51b815260206004820152602a60248201527f5361666545524332303a204552433230206f7065726174696f6e20646964206e6044820152691bdd081cdd58d8d9595960b21b6064820152608401610ad5565b606061181a8484600085611824565b90505b9392505050565b6060824710156118855760405162461bcd60e51b815260206004820152602660248201527f416464726573733a20696e73756666696369656e742062616c616e636520666f6044820152651c8818d85b1b60d21b6064820152608401610ad5565b843b6118d35760405162461bcd60e51b815260206004820152601d60248201527f416464726573733a2063616c6c20746f206e6f6e2d636f6e74726163740000006044820152606401610ad5565b600080866001600160a01b031685876040516118ef9190611b33565b60006040518083038185875af1925050503d806000811461192c576040519150601f19603f3d011682016040523d82523d6000602084013e611931565b606091505b50915091506110d88282866060831561194b57508161181d565b82511561195b5782518084602001fd5b8160405162461bcd60e51b8152600401610ad59190611b4f565b600060208284031215611986578081fd5b813561181d81611d31565b600080602083850312156119a3578081fd5b823567ffffffffffffffff808211156119ba578283fd5b818501915085601f8301126119cd578283fd5b8135818111156119db578384fd5b8660208260051b85010111156119ef578384fd5b60209290920196919550909350505050565b600060208284031215611a12578081fd5b815161181d81611d49565b600060208284031215611a2e578081fd5b5035919050565b600060208284031215611a46578081fd5b5051919050565b60008060408385031215611a5f578182fd5b823591506020830135611a7181611d31565b809150509250929050565b600080600060608486031215611a90578081fd5b833592506020840135611aa281611d31565b91506040840135611ab281611d31565b809150509250925092565b600080600060608486031215611ad1578283fd5b83359250602084013591506040840135611ab281611d31565b60008060008060808587031215611aff578081fd5b84359350602085013592506040850135611b1881611d31565b91506060850135611b2881611d49565b939692955090935050565b60008251611b45818460208701611cd4565b9190910192915050565b6020815260008251806020840152611b6e816040850160208701611cd4565b601f01601f19169190910160400192915050565b6020808252818101527f4f776e61626c653a2063616c6c6572206973206e6f7420746865206f776e6572604082015260600190565b9485526001600160a01b0393841660208601529190921660408401526060830191909152608082015260a00190565b600080821280156001600160ff1b0384900385131615611c0857611c08611d1b565b600160ff1b8390038412811615611c2157611c21611d1b565b50500190565b60008219821115611c3a57611c3a611d1b565b500190565b600082611c5a57634e487b7160e01b81526012600452602481fd5b500490565b6000816000190483118215151615611c7957611c79611d1b565b500290565b60008083128015600160ff1b850184121615611c9c57611c9c611d1b565b6001600160ff1b0384018313811615611cb757611cb7611d1b565b50500390565b600082821015611ccf57611ccf611d1b565b500390565b60005b83811015611cef578181015183820152602001611cd7565b83811115610aa55750506000910152565b6000600019821415611d1457611d14611d1b565b5060010190565b634e487b7160e01b600052601160045260246000fd5b6001600160a01b0381168114611d4657600080fd5b50565b8015158114611d4657600080fdfea264697066735822122055760634264f5c13be56428cec23909702da0f58d027603c16330c3ca30090df64736f6c63430008040033